Late run helps Blue Hens earn a 73-67 victory over Northeastern

Advertisements

Blue Hens lead by one point at the end of the first half.

The game started with Northeastern flying off to an 11-2 advantage with 14:49 remaining in the opening half.

Seconds later, Delaware would punch back by outscoring the Huskies 26-16 to grab a 28-27 lead with 5:17 left in the first half.

Niels Lane took command of the offense during this stretch, scoring ten of the team’s 26 points.

UD’s defense also stepped up during this time, as the unit collected seven defensive rebounds, one block, and one steal.

The Blue Hens would score nine more points in the first half to hold a 37-36 advantage at the end of the opening half.

Delaware takes home a 73-67 victory!

Fast forward to the 17:30 minute mark, where Niels Lane would get a layup to go in to push UD’s edge to ten points (48-38).

A minute and 16 seconds later, Northeastern would claw back into this game, as the team went on a 15-7 run to slice the deficit to two points (55-53) with 9:05 remaining in the second half.

The Huskies would continue their comeback as the team outscored the Hens 9-6 in the next couple of minutes to grab a 62-61 lead with 4:06 left in the game.

After losing the lead, the Blue Hens would storm back and go on a 12-5 run to seal a 73-67 victory over Northeastern. 

Jyáre Davis and Gerald Drumgoole Jr. would be a tough duo for the Huskies to stop, as they scored eight of the team’s 12 points.
